Q: Is 297,742 a Prime Number?
A: No, 297,742 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 297742 can be evenly divided by 1 2 41 82 3,631 7,262 148,871 and 297,742, with no remainder.
Since 297,742 cannot be divided by just 1 and 297,742, it is not a prime number.
